Klappentext zu „Forensic DNA Analysis “
This volume focuses on the latest techniques used in forensic DNA analysis. The chapters include a comprehensive collection of extraction, quantification, STR amplification, and detection methods for routine forensic samples, including manual, semi-automated, and automated procedures using both home-brew and commercial products. The chapters also discuss probabilistic modeling software and specialized start-to-finish procedures for mitochondrial DNA analysis, archived latent fingerprints, latent DNA, rapid DNA profiling, and next-generation sequencing. Written in the highly successful Methods in Molecular Biology series format, chapters include introduction to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ls.Cutting-edge and practical, Forensic DNA Analysis: Methods and Protocols is a valuable resource for researchers interested in learning more about forensic DNA analysis procedures.
